Crafting Digital Solutions

The software development lifecycle is a structured process that guides the creation of computational solutions. It involves several stages, each with its own {specific{ goals and deliverables. From initiation to launch, this lifecycle ensures a clear path for bringing innovative software to life.

  • Initially, requirements are thoroughly defined, outlining the features of the software.
  • Subsequently, developers write the code based on these requirements, adhering to best practices and coding standards.
  • Simultaneously, testing is conducted at various stages to ensure the software is reliable.
  • Finally, the software is launched for use by its target audience.

The software development lifecycle is a ever-evolving process, with feedback from users often leading to improvements. This iterative nature allows for the creation of software that is user-friendly, meeting the ever-changing needs of the digital world.

Exploring the World of Mobile App Development

The mobile app development landscape is constantly transforming, presenting both challenges and opportunities for aspiring developers. To successfully in this dynamic environment, it's crucial to possess a strong foundation in programming languages like Java or Swift, along with a deep understanding of user interface design principles.

A key aspect of mobile app development is choosing the right platform, whether it's iOS for Apple devices or Android for a wider range of smartphones. , Additionally , developers must consider factors such as target audience, app functionality, and budget constraints when planning their projects.

Successful mobile app development often involves a collaborative process that includes designers, testers, and marketers. By utilizing the expertise of various professionals, developers can create high-quality apps that meet user expectations and achieve business goals.
